G3468
Greek Text
Strong's Concordance

μώλωψ

Phoneticmo'-lopes
Transliterationmṓlōps
Grammar Code
G:N-M
Greek Noun, Masculine
Strong's Definition
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

stripe. - probably akin to the base of μόλις) and probably (the face - from ὀπτάνομαι) - a mole ("black eye") or blow-mark

Scripture References

Occurrences in the Bible

1 total references
ReferenceText
1 Peter 2:24

Who his own self bare our sins in his own body on the tree, that we, being dead to sins, should live unto righteousness: by whose stripes ye were healed.
